Missing 16-year-old Tiverton girl with sightings in Fall River found safe

Police and family members are asking for the public’s assistance to locate a missing 16-year-old female.

Avah Victoria Flower went missing at 5:30 p.m. on Friday from Tiverton.

Avah was wearing a tan “crop top” sweatshirt and camo sweatpants.

She is approximately 5’7″, 155 lbs, has brown eyes, and straight long brown hair with blonde highlights.

Avah is endangered and family members are concerned that she could be disoriented as she does not have her medication.

She could be in the Newport, Portsmouth, or Middletown area, but was last seen getting off of a bus at the Fall River bus terminal on Friday.

Anyone with information is asked to contact Sergeant Ryan Huber or Officer Jack Barter at (401) 625-6717. Anyone who sees Avah is asked to call 911.
